Parallax Inc. commits free robots and training to 500 educators in 2018!

 

In a direct effort to equip students with electronics and coding skills, Parallax announced an entirely free Professional Development program for up to 500 teachers at 16 locations throughout the United States.

January 10, 2018 -  Rocklin, California - Parallax Inc. opened enrollment for 500 teachers in one-day “Robotics with Blockly” Professional Development courses around the country. Teachers from middle school through college—with no prior experience—will bring their computers and spend a day building and programming their own robot, and learning how to build electronic circuits with sensors and motors.  

 

The Parallax Professional Development program provides educators the confidence and skills to implement STEM and robotics curricula in their own classrooms. The hands-on, immersive training is conducted in their community at their pace using a visual programming language based on Google’s Blockly, customized for a commercial microcontroller. Educators who have implemented Parallax’s program find that their students prefer learning to code with real robots and sensors.       

 

“Parallax removed all the barriers teachers experience so they can quickly put robotics curriculum into their classrooms. The best way we can help the United States advance our engineering and manufacturing capability is with real-world tools and components instead of STEM learning ‘toys’, and we are leading the way. The educational and economic benefits to students are real—they will be exposed to the same systems used in aerospace, self-driving cars, entertainment, and computer-controlled manufacturing, learning about prototyping and engineering” says Ken Gracey of Parallax.    

 

The Parallax effort is not purely commercial. The company founders grew a mid-80s personal computing hobby into an engineering business by creating the same tools they would have liked to use as students. Parallax has trained over 5,000 teachers and has placed over one million robots in schools.

Parallax Inc. is a privately owned company based out of Rocklin, California, specializing in embedded electronics and robotics education. Their 38 employees work in engineering, education, manufacturing and curriculum development.
